Abstract

A friction fit seal provides enhanced stability and installation as compared to conventional configurations. The seal includes a seal body having a longitudinal axis; a retention rib that extends from the seal body in a lateral direction perpendicular to the longitudinal axis; and at least one stabilizer rib that extends from the seal body in the lateral direction and is spaced apart from the retention rib along the longitudinal axis. A lateral width of the stabilizer rib in the lateral direction is smaller than a lateral width of the retention rib. The seal may be a keyhole seal in which the seal body includes an inner surface and an outer surface, and the inner surface defines a hollow center that may be keyhole shaped. The seal may include a solid central main body, and the stabilizer ribs and the retention rib are configured as lobes that extend in the lateral direction from the solid central main body.

Claims (36)

1. A seal comprising:

a seal body having a longitudinal axis;

rounded sealing surfaces of a radial cross-section of the seal body located at opposing longitudinal ends of the seal body in an undeformed state;

a retention rib that extends from the seal body in a lateral direction perpendicular to the longitudinal axis; and

at least one stabilizer rib that extends from the seal body in the lateral direction and is spaced apart from the retention rib along the longitudinal axis;

wherein a lateral width of the stabilizer rib in the lateral direction is smaller than a lateral width of the retention rib;

wherein the at least one stabilizer rib includes, on each side of the longitudinal axis, first and second stabilizer ribs located on opposing sides of the retention rib along the longitudinal axis, wherein a lateral width of each of the first and second stabilizer ribs is smaller than the lateral width of the retention rib; and

wherein the seal is symmetrical about the longitudinal axis and a lateral axis perpendicular to the longitudinal axis.

2. The seal of claim 1 , wherein the seal body includes an inner surface and an outer surface, and the inner surface defines a hollow center.

3. The seal of claim 2 , wherein the seal has a keyhole shape.

4. The seal of claim 2 , wherein the inner surface defines a keyhole shape hollow center.

5. The seal of claim 1 , wherein the seal comprises a solid central main body, and the at least one stabilizer rib and the retention rib are configured as lobes that extend in the lateral direction from the solid central main body.

6. The seal of claim 1 , wherein the seal is made of an elastomeric material.

7. The seal of claim 1 , wherein the retention rib is located centrally relative to the at least one stabilizer rib.

8. The seal of claim 1 , wherein the retention rib and the at least one stabilizer rib extend from an outer surface of the seal, and the at least one stabilizer rib extends a smaller distance from a centerline longitudinal axis of the seal as compared to the retention rib.

9. A seal assembly comprising:

a first component having a first mating surface that defines a sealing groove;

a seal according to claim 1 that is located within the sealing groove; and

a second mating component having a second mating surface;

wherein the seal is reconfigured from a non-compressed state to a compressed state when the first component is joined with the second component, and in the compressed state the seal seals at a junction between the first mating surface and the second mating surface.

10. The sealed assembly of claim 9 , wherein in the non-compressed state, the lateral width of the retention rib is greater than a width of the sealing groove.

11. The seal assembly according to claim 9 , wherein in a fully compressed state, the junction is a substantially gapless interface of the first mating surface and the second mating surface.
